China has told the head of the European diplomacy, Kie Kallas, that it cannot allow Russia to lose in the Ukrainian conflict. It is reported by The South China Morning Post (SCMP), citing sources.
According to several people familiar with the negotiations,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i told the head of the EU's top diplomat on Wednesday that Beijing could not allow Russia's defeat at the Ukraine, because it fears that then the United States will shift all its attention to Beijing," the note says.
It is noted that some EU representatives were surprised by the frankness of Wang Yi's statements.
At the same time, according to sources, Wang Yi rejected accusations that China is providing material support to Russia's military actions, be it financial or military assistance, and said that if this were the case, the conflict would have ended long ago.
During the four-hour talks on a wide range of geopolitical and commercial issues, Wang Yi gave Callas several "history lessons and lectures," the sources said. According to two officials, some representatives The EU considered that "he taught her a lesson in real politics, partly related to Beijing's belief that Washington will soon completely switch its attention to Vostok," the newspaper writes.
